Job Summary

The Transportation Operations Coordinator provides operational transportation coordination and contingency mobility support for Task 5 emergent operations activities in support of the ILS2 Task Order. This role is responsible for coordinating rapid-response transportation activities, supporting contingency mobility operations, synchronizing movement support functions, and facilitating mission-critical transportation requirements associated with regional crises, natural disasters, partner nation support missions, and national-level taskings.

Working closely with Government leadership, mission partners, logistics teams, transportation personnel, communications support staff, cyber support teams, operational stakeholders, and contingency response organizations, the Transportation Operations Coordinator helps ensure transportation activities remain operationally synchronized, responsive, and aligned with mission objectives. The position supports a wide range of mobility requirements, including passenger movement, equipment transport, medical evacuation support, supply distribution, deployable operational platforms, and contingency operations. Through effective coordination and rapid response planning, this role contributes to mission success by maintaining transportation readiness and operational agility in dynamic and evolving environments.

This position is contingent upon award of the contract.

Roles and Responsibilities
  • Coordinate transportation and mobility activities supporting Task 5 contingency, emergency response, and expeditionary operations.
  • Support rapid-response transportation requirements associated with crisis response, natural disasters, partner nation support missions, and other emergent operational activities.
  • Synchronize movement support operations and coordinate transportation resources to support mission execution requirements.
  • Coordinate with Government personnel, logistics teams, transportation providers, communications support personnel, cyber support teams, and contingency response organizations to ensure effective operational integration.
  • Support transportation coordination for passenger movement, equipment transport, supply delivery, and operational support missions.
  • Assist with coordination of CASEVAC, MEDEVAC, patient retrieval, and other mission-critical transportation requirements as directed.
  • Support mobility planning and transportation readiness activities associated with deployable operational platforms and expeditionary operations.
  • Monitor transportation activities and provide operational updates, movement status reports, and transportation coordination support to leadership and stakeholders.
  • Identify transportation constraints, operational risks, and mobility challenges and assist in the implementation of mitigation strategies.
  • Support continuity of operations by ensuring transportation resources and movement support capabilities remain available and responsive during contingency situations.
